Study on Modification of Raw Bamboo Fabric and Dyeing Properties

Article Preview

Abstract:

The cellulose of raw bamboo fabric was first prepared by selective oxidation with NaIO4. Then the oxidized raw bamboo fabric was modified by sericin protein solution. The dyeing characteristic was studied. Also, the dyeing effect such as K/S value, color fastness, leveling properties were evaluated and compared with unmodified raw bamboo fabric. The results showed that the dyeing properties of oxidized raw bamboo fabric modified by sericin protein were improved. Furthermore, the whiteness of the modified raw bamboo fabric was decreased and the water absorption property was improved.
